Wireless gaming headsets: Play without cables getting in the way

A wireless gaming headset gives your desk a cleaner look and lets you move more freely while you play. It’s handy if you switch between chatting, streaming and grabbing a drink between rounds. Many models use a USB dongle for a steady connection, which helps keep sound in step with the action on screen.

Built for PC and laptop setups

A wireless PC gaming headset is ideal for a tower setup, while a wireless gaming headset for laptop use keeps things simple when you game in different rooms. Check the connection type before you buy, as some headsets use USB-A, USB-C or Bluetooth. If your laptop has fewer ports, a compact dongle or Bluetooth model may be the neater choice.

Clear chat, comfy fit and longer sessions

Sound matters, but comfort does too. Look for padded ear cups, an adjustable headband and a mic that picks up your voice clearly. Some headsets also include spatial audio, so in-game sounds feel easier to place. Battery life is worth checking as well, especially if you play for hours or forget to charge between sessions.
